Creating a catalog archiving policy

The catalog archiving feature requires the presence of a policy named catarc before the catalog archiving commands can run properly. The policy can be reused for catalog archiving.

To create a catalog archiving policy

  1. Create a new policy and name it catarc. The catarc policy waits until bpcatarc can activate it. Users do not run this policy. Instead, bpcatarc activates this special policy to perform a catalog backup job, then deactivates the policy after the job is done.
  2. In the Attributes policy tab, set the Policy type to Standard or MS-Windows, according to the platform of the master server.
  3. In the Attributes policy tab, deactivate the catalog archive policy by clearing the Go into effect at field.

    See Go into effect at (policy attribute).

  4. Select the Schedules tab and click New to create a schedule.

    In the Attributes schedule tab, the Name of the schedule is not restricted, but the Type of backup must be User Backup.

  5. Select a Retention for the catalog archive. Set the retention level for a time at least as long as the longest retention period of the backups being archived. Data can be lost if the retention level of the catalog archive is not long enough.

    You may find it useful to set up, and then designate a special retention level for catalog archive images.

  6. Select the Start Window tab and define a schedule for the catarc policy.

    The schedule must include in its window the time when the bpcatarc command is run. If the bpcatarc command is run outside of the schedule, the operation fails.

  7. Click OK to save the schedule.
  8. On the Clients tab, enter the name of the master server as it appears on the NetBackup servers list.
  9. On the Backup Selections tab, browse to the directory where catalog backup images are placed:

    On Windows: install_path\NetBackup\db\images

    On UNIX: /usr/openv/netbackup/db/images

  10. Save the policy.
